GK60 YNZ is a 2010 Mazda MX-5 in Grey with a 1,999cc petrol engine. This vehicle has been through 16 MOT tests with a personal pass rate of 87.5%.
Across all 2010 Mazda MX-5 models, the average MOT pass rate is 83.7% with a typical mileage of 40,760 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Mazda MX-5 fails its MOT is seat belt anchorage prescribed area is excessively corroded, accounting for 44,475 recorded failures. If you're considering buying GK60 YNZ, it's worth having these areas checked by a mechanic before committing.
The Mazda MX-5 typically stays on UK roads for around 36 years. At 16 years old, this Mazda MX-5 is still in the earlier part of its expected life.
